首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>如何在使用异步方法时调试异常

如何在使用异步方法时调试异常
EN

Stack Overflow用户
提问于 2018-06-09 02:14:49
回答 1查看 726关注 0票数 1

在asp.net MVC中,当我调试和单步执行代码时,调试器会停在有问题的行处,并向我显示在try..catch中没有该行的情况下抛出的异常。但是,当处理await..async类型的行时,调试器不会暂停,在我有机会在调试器中看到异常之前,异常只是作为响应返回。在VS2017中有没有一个设置,我可以暂停调试器,并在调用异步方法时检查这个异常?

EN

回答 1

Stack Overflow用户

发布于 2018-06-09 04:54:32

只需提前按F9在所需的方法中手动放置一个断点。该方法中的第一行代码是一个很好的逻辑位置。然后启动一个调试器,按照您的方式执行常见的F10F5。在某个点(你不能控制),你会在期望的点停下来。

票数 -1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/50766332

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档